Understanding the Application and Approval Process
The application process for a payday loan from a direct lender is generally quite straightforward. Most lenders offer online applications that can be completed in a matter of minutes. The required information typically includes personal details such as name, address, date of birth, and employment information. You’ll also be asked to provide details about your income and bank account. Providing accurate information is crucial to ensure a smooth and efficient application process. The lender will then assess your ability to repay the loan, often by verifying your income and checking your credit history. It is important to note that even with a less-than-perfect credit score, approval is still possible, but the interest rates may be higher.
Factors Affecting Loan Approval
Several factors influence the approval of a payday loan. Lenders primarily focus on your ability to repay the loan on your next payday. This is assessed by verifying your income and employment status. A stable income source is a significant indicator of your capacity to fulfil your repayment obligations. While credit checks are still performed, they are often not the sole determining factor. Lenders will also consider your debt-to-income ratio, which compares your monthly debt payments to your monthly income. A lower ratio indicates a better ability to manage additional debt. Finally, any existing payday loans or short-term borrowing arrangements will also be taken into account, as lenders aim to avoid placing borrowers in a cycle of debt.
| Factor | Description | Impact on Approval |
|---|---|---|
| Income Verification | Proof of stable income source | High – essential for approval |
| Credit History | Review of credit report for past borrowing behaviour | Moderate – influences interest rates |
| Debt-to-Income Ratio | Comparison of debts to income | Moderate – impacts loan amount |
| Existing Loans | Current short-term borrowing arrangements | High – may hinder approval |
Once approved, the loan amount, along with any associated fees, is typically deposited directly into your bank account within a short timeframe, often the same day or within 24 hours. The terms of the loan, including the repayment date, will be clearly outlined in the loan agreement.

The Role of Regulation and Consumer Protection
The payday loan industry in the UK is heavily regulated by the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A). The FCA’s regulations are designed to protect consumers from unfair lending practices and to ensure that lenders operate responsibly. These regulations include measures such as affordability checks, caps on interest rates and fees, and restrictions on the number of times a loan can be rolled over. Before choosing a lender, verify that they are fully authorised and regulated by the FCA. You can check the FCA’s register online to confirm a lender’s credentials. This provides peace of mind knowing that the lender is subject to regulatory oversight and that your rights as a consumer are protected.
Exploring Alternatives to Payday Loans
While payday loans can be a useful tool in certain situations, it’s important to explore alternative options before resorting to borrowing. These alternatives may include borrowing from friends or family, utilizing a credit card cash advance, or seeking assistance from a debt charity. Credit unions often offer more affordable loans with lower interest rates than payday lenders. Government assistance programs may also be available to individuals experiencing financial hardship. Exploring these alternatives can help you avoid the high costs and potential risks associated with payday loans and find a more sustainable solution to your financial challenges. Considering all options allows you to make an informed decision based on your individual circumstances.
